檢查備份日:每年的 2 月 1 日。

http://checkyourbackups.work/

這是 GitLab 誤刪資料庫事件的延續。

GitLab 有多重 備份策略,包括

  1. 人工的 LVM (最近一次是 6 小時前)
  2. 自動定期備份 (發現爛掉了)
  3. 硬碟備份 (嗯,不包括資料庫)
  4. WebHook 同步備份 (先前拿掉了)
  5. Replication 複製流程 (發現爛掉了)
  6. 備份到 S3 (發現是空的,根本沒備份成功)

前面六種備份策略,爛得爛、死得死,只剩下第一種可行,但也只能恢復 6 個小時前的資料。

所以網路酸民為 GitLab 此次事件立碑為《 檢查備份日 》,請務必隨時檢查你的備份是不是真的有用。